Internet

Internet

Is “Irreplaceable” Irreplaceable?

Internet

Chinese EV sales drop in Jan amid decreased demand

Internet

The Best Budget & Enthusiast-Level SSDs

Internet

Largest Comet Ever Detected On Way To Earth

Internet

Venomous Spiders Are Hiding in Our Grapes

Internet

Buying a Budget PC: DIY vs. OEM

Internet

My Friend Ellis By Geoffrey Mak February 27, 2024